Factors Affecting Cost
- Type of Wood: Different wood species vary in price, with options like cedar and redwood being more expensive than pine.
- Labor Costs: Local labor rates in Topeka, KS, can significantly impact the overall project cost.
- Home Size: Larger homes require more materials and labor, increasing the total cost.
- Removal of Old Cladding: The cost to remove existing cladding can add to the overall expense.
- Installation Complexity: Intricate designs or hard-to-reach areas can make the installation process more labor-intensive and costly.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may require permits and inspections, adding to the total cost.
- Weather Conditions: Seasonal weather variations in Topeka can affect labor availability and project timelines.
